Shpock: Buy & Sell Marketplace
Throughout Q3 2021, Shpock: Buy & Sell Marketplace exper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$7.9K in the first week of July and dipping to around $5.2K by mid-August. Weekly downloads showed a steady increase, culminating in 8.7K by the week of September 20. The app maintained a solid user base with weekly active users hovering around 120K to 130K, closing the quarter at approximately 116K.
HotStock - in-stock alerts
HotStock - in-stock alerts saw a progressive rise in weekly revenue, starting at $1.9K at the end of June and peaking at about $2.5K by the third week of September. Weekly downloads surged significantly, from 1.1K in early July to over 3.8K by the end of September. Active user numbers also rose steadily, reaching approximately 12.5K by the quarter's end.
Buy and sell - Marketplace
The performance of Buy and sell - Marketplace included a notable increase in weekly revenue, from $816 in late June to nearly $2K by early September. Downloads similarly increased, starting at 636 and peaking at 1.4K by the end of September. Active users showed a positive trend, growing from 784 in late June to over 1.3K by the end of the quarter.
LootBoy: Packs. Drops. Games.
LootBoy: Packs. Drops. Games. exper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, starting at $707 in late June and reaching $1.2K by the last week of September. Weekly downloads saw a significant spike, especially in the week of September 6, with 602 downloads.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 2.5K and 3.7K throughout the quarter.
